WebStudies show that phototherapy can safely and effectively treat children with eczema. Phototherapy can reduce stubborn eczema. In some cases, it clears the skin. Phototherapy can reduce your child’s need for medicine applied to the skin. Phototherapy may increase the risk of developing skin cancer later in life, but this risk seems low. WebDyshidrotic eczema affects the skin around the palms of your hands, fingers and soles of your feet. Your skin may develop bumps or blisters that look like tapioca pearls. These blisters are typically one to two millimeters in diameter. The blisters may come together to form one large blister.
